What is a Yeast Infection?

The first step toward yeast infection prevention is to understand what a yeast infection is. The body is filled with natural flora that helps to keep the body functioning normally. One such flora is candida albicans, which is a natural inhabitant of the vagina. Certain things, like heat and antibiotics, can cause an overgrowth of this flora. When this happens, a woman has a yeast infection and must seek treatment for symptoms such as burning, itching, redness and other discomforts.

Heat and Yeast Infections:

One of the most common ways for those who suffer recurring overgrowth of candida to prevent yeast infections is to be particular about clothing. Nylon and Lycra tend to trap heat—cotton doesn’t. Simply put, then, keep cotton as the closest material to areas where candida is naturally found. Also, avoid wearing pantyhose; it may be helpful to trade pantyhose for more traditional stockings.

A Cup a Day:

Another yeast infection prevention that can be easily maintained is to eat a cup of yogurt with live cultures everyday. The bacteria in the yogurt helps to prevent the overgrowth of candida. This proactive measure is found to be especially helpful for women who have recently undergone treatments with antibiotics, because the antibiotics often kill the natural bacteria that keep the candida in check. By adding live cultures back to the system, an overgrowth is not as likely to happen.

Bath and Body:

Along with clothing and food, there are a few things you can do to for yeast infection prevention. These steps include:

  • Avoid perfume bath salts or powders that can irritation and cause an increase in candida
  • Always wipe front to back after a bowel movement
  • Avoid douches that rob the vagina of needed mucous that helps keep candida from overgrowth.

By following these simple yeast infection prevention tips, you can reduce the occurence, the endless itching, and the subsequent treatments.
